This Conegliano Valdobbiadene Prosecco Superiore DOCG Brut is made by a single and secondary fermentation process using only the natural sugar from cooled Glera grapes, in order to preserve and maintain their natural characteristics. A slow fermentation process at low temperatures ensures the correct acidic structure, an excellent level of quality, and a full bouquet expressive of the land in which it was created. The secondary fermentation takes place in an autoclave at a controlled temperature of 14-15°C.
- Total acidity: 6.5g/l.
- PH: 3.2.
- Residual sugar: 9g/l.
- Grape varietal: Glera.
- Alcohol % by volume: 11.5%.
- Country of origin: Italy.
- Light pressing with the Pneumatic press and settling of the must.
- Grape harvest period: the last ten days of September
- Appearance: straw yellow with hues of green, the finest Perlage which ensure the persistence of flavor.
- Aroma: fresh and elegant, with notes of apple and pear, which makes it very pleasant.
- Palate: soft, aromatic, with a fresh acidity
- Serving temperature: 6-8°C.
- Food pairings: excellent as an aperitif. Superb match with seafood, appetizers, and light and delicate dishes.
